I recently upgraded to Tiger (Mac OSX 4.1). Prior to upgrading, I was able to scan by importing into Photoshop CS2 just fine. I uninstalled Silverfast (app and all preferences), downloaded the latest driver (6.4.2r1) and installed. When it tries to lauch Ai (from photoshop import) I get an error message "There was no scanner found!" - etc. I can launch the SF Launcher and it finds the scanner just fine.
HELP!!
PS I forgot to mention that this is all on my external firewire hard drive. I want to test Tiger here before upgrading to it on my eMac.
IT'S WORKING! I uninstalled everything, downloaded SFE-6.4.1r9a(Epson).sit for my Epson 1240U scanner. Installed and it's working!!!
